    I want to allow another person to create additional forms in our Jotform account, but I don't want them to be able to edit/modify the existing forms that we have right now. Maybe even do not let that person even see those forms, so they start with an empty account, when they login with their user name and password?

    Is this possible?

    Or do I have to get another account just for that person?

    do I have to get another account just for that person?

    From what I understand on your requirement, this is the right option.

    The Sub account feature of the Form Builder can only have the Edit and View permissions on forms of the main account. It does not have the Add/Create form permission option.
